Social activist, S Banshai Marbaniang has urged the Meghalaya Cooperative Apex Bank (MCAB) to install an Automated Teller Machine (ATM) in Mawsynram.
Pointing out that the branch in Mawsynram has more than 70,000 customers, which also caters to people from Tyrsad areas to Ranikor C&RD Block, Marbaniang said installing an ATM machine would prevent long queue in the bank.
He said customers have to wait for long hours even for updating their passbooks and cash withdrawal especially during market days.
Based on the concerns Marbaniang met MCAB Managing Director, O. Nongbri in Shillong yesterday and submitted a memorandum with the request.
